Tencent Cloud Supports Changan Tianshu Navigation

Tencent Autonomous Driving Cloud is providing data closed-loop support for “Changan Tianshu Navigation,” a newly launched intelligent driving assistance technology brand from China Changan Automobile Group Co., Ltd. (CCAG). The service is being delivered through Tencent Smart Mobility, the smart mobility business of Tencent Holdings Limited. The Changan NEVO Q06 is the first model equipped with Tianshu Navigation Ultra, and the vehicle has opened for pre-orders. The cooperation connects intelligent driving data operations with development and deployment processes, creating a closed loop from real-world road data collection through validation, model training, and vehicle updates.

Tianshu Navigation Offers Four Intelligent Driving Versions

Tianshu Navigation is offered in four versions: Pro, Max, Ultra, and Ultimate. Each version is equipped with LiDAR and uses an end-to-end architecture for intelligent driving assistance. Within this framework, Tencent Autonomous Driving Cloud supports multiple operational functions, including intelligent driving data collection and upload, data production and mining, simulation testing, and model training. The system is designed to process information generated by vehicles operating on real-world roads and connect that information with the development workflow required to improve intelligent driving models and functions.

Data Collection and Model Development Form a Closed Loop

The cloud-supported workflow enables road data collected by vehicles to be cleaned and annotated before undergoing validation through simulation. The processed data can then be used for model training, with resulting updates deployed back to vehicles through over-the-air (OTA) updates. This creates a continuous data closed loop between vehicle operation and intelligent driving development. According to Tencent, the process reduces the time required for data collection and upload from days to hours. The faster movement of information through the development pipeline is intended to support more efficient iteration of intelligent driving functions.

Simulation and Data Production Capacity Increase

Tencent said development cycles for its data annotation and simulation testing platforms have been shortened by several months. At the same time, data production capacity has increased while using the same amount of computing power. These improvements affect several stages of the intelligent driving development process, from preparing collected road information to testing system performance in simulated environments. By improving the speed and capacity of these operations without increasing the stated computing resources, the platform can support a more efficient workflow for China Changan's intelligent driving development activities.

Next Phase of Tencent and CCAG Cooperation

Going forward, Tencent and China Changan Automobile Group Co., Ltd. plan to broaden their cooperation around computing power used for intelligent driving model training. The companies also plan to jointly build an integrated system covering AI infrastructure and data infrastructure. In addition, they intend to explore the use of world models and multimodal models in intelligent driving scenarios. The planned expansion indicates that the cooperation is moving beyond individual data-processing functions toward a broader infrastructure approach supporting model development and intelligent driving applications.
